Abstract
In an embodiment, a method is provided. The method of this embodiment provides receiving a request for data from a processor of a plurality of processors, determining a cache entry location based, at least in part, on the request, storing the data in a cache corresponding to the processor at the cache entry location, and storing a coherency record corresponding to the data in a snoop filter in accordance with one of the following, if there is a cache miss: at the cache entry location of a corresponding affinity in the snoop filter if the cache entry location is found in the corresponding affinity, or at a derived cache entry location of the corresponding affinity if the cache entry location is not found in the corresponding affinity.
